The nursery rhyme Thomas Edison heard when he turned the handle of the first phonograph was "Mary Had a Little Lamb." This demonstration showcased the ability of the phonograph to record and play back sound, marking a significant moment in the history of audio technology.

The phonograph created the recorded-music industry in America. For the first time, people could completely controlled what they listened to, in the comfort of their homes. The phonograph was also the first step on the road to records, cassette tapes, CD's, and the MP3 player.
